Washington D.C. – Former special counsel Jack Smith's recent accusations regarding the Justice Department's actions under the Trump administration have ignited a debate concerning the potential politicization of law enforcement and the integrity of the judicial process. Smith claimed at a private event last month that DOJ leaders targeted individuals for prosecution to curry favor with former President Donald Trump.

Throughout history, concerns about the politicization of law enforcement have been raised. The Teapot Dome scandal in the 1920s, for instance, involved allegations of corruption and political influence within the Harding administration, highlighting the potential for abuse of power.
Similarly, the investigations into alleged Russian interference in the 2016 election led to questions about the impartiality of the Justice Department and the FBI. These historical precedents underscore the importance of maintaining transparency and accountability in law enforcement.
